Transaction 2c33d620b842fe91c274d37d7e8b772da687972b4d79a270551e825d4aecfe24
1 Input
1 Output
-
2c33d620b842fe91c274d37d7e8b772da687972b4d79a270551e825d4aecfe24:0
- value
- 526490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 deb3a1f5a43dcd526fa3769b0675965e8fa0da1c OP_EQUAL
- address
- 3MzZ8E3fQPhjswXKi3orhLs1aEE4CMbqwT